What Is Health Law?

Health law covers all the regulations and legal issues related to health care providers, patients, and the health care system. It includes laws about patient rights, health care fraud, medical malpractice, health insurance, and regulating health care providers and facilities. Health laws in Arizona ensure that health care providers deliver their services fairly, safely, and ethically. Health law protects both patients and providers. This area of law also addresses public health policies, the confidentiality of medical records, and the regulation of drugs and medical devices.

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Health Lawyer?

Patients, doctors, providers, medical device manufacturers, and anyone else adjacent to the health care field might need a health lawyer someday. You might need a health law lawyer if you’re facing issues with medical malpractice, such as if you’ve been harmed by a health care provider’s negligence. If you’re a health care provider dealing with regulatory compliance, licensing issues, or accusations of health care fraud, a lawyer can help. Other situations include disputes over health insurance claims, patient rights violations, or navigating complex health laws and regulations.

What Could Happen if I Don’t Hire a Health Law Lawyer?

Without legal guidance, you could struggle to navigate complex health care regulations, risking fines or loss of your health care license if you’re a provider. You might be unable to distinguish the regulations of the federal, Fort Defiance, and Arizona governments. Patients might miss out on compensation for medical malpractice or have difficulty asserting their rights. Health care providers could face increased liability, compliance issues, and legal disputes without proper representation. A health law lawyer helps ensure you understand and meet legal requirements, protecting your rights and interests in the health care system and helping you avoid costly legal problems.
